This bangle set was designed by Lena Ehsan Jafery and is made up of two bangles. Each bangle has stainless steel as its base and has been flash plated with 14k rose gold. Zircon stones have been inlayed in one of the bracelets. Drawing inspiration from ballerinas and their seemingly effortless grace, the second bracelet is fringed with tulle. Lena Ehsan Jafery is a 21 year old Pakistani-American artist, designer, and writer. Lena has won multiple awards including being a Young Arts Finalist, and a Scholastic Art & Writing Award recipient. Her work in textiles, sculpture, photography & fashion has been featured in juried art shows and exhibitions, including at the Kennedy Center and in a New York City gallery. She is currently a student in the fashion department of the School of the Art Institute of Chicago.
